Dexit Expand Beyond Toronto Downtown Merchants

Tuesday 28 September 2004 17:10 CET | News

Canadian based Dexit is celebrating its one-year anniversary by taking the service beyond downtown merchants to major institutional locations.

Dexits first year of operations has seen a flurry of activity with the Dexit service installed in the downtown Toronto sites of key merchants such as A & W, KFC, Pharma Plus Drugmarts, Rexall Drug Stores, Burger King, Timothys World Coffee, Macs Convenience Stores, Petro-Canada, Mr. Sub, Subway, mmmuffins, Krispy Kreme Doughnuts, Dairy Queen, Gateway Newstands, Druxys Famous Deli and others. In recent weeks Dexit has also added new merchants such as Lettieri and International News to the ever-increasing list of locations using the Dexit service. Dexit is also expanding by locating in major institutional locations such as Scarborough General Hospital and Scarborough Grace Hospital, as well as Ryerson University, George Brown College, York University, The Michener Institute and corporate cafeterias at Ernst & Young, Bell Mobility Creekbank and the Tridel head office complex.
